AFDA to showcase visual talent

AFDA students gear up for Experimental Film Festival.

AFDA will host its annual experimental festival at its Durban North campus on Saturday, 20 June. The experimental festival geared at third year students allows them to discover and express their artistic intent as well as experiment with film, theatre and television craft techniques.

This will be the first time Durban will host the event and three pupils excited about the upcoming festival are local students, Vashil Ramdharee, Stefan Rust and Tayla-Rae Coetzer. Northglen News recently caught up with the trio to find out more about their journey into film.

“It’s always been a passion of mine to tell stories and make the audience feel real emotions. South Africa and Durban in particular has some amazing settings and this festival for me allows me to showcase my artistic side. My film is called Do You Believe In Love and it took me two days to shoot. I decided to film in black and white and it’s a thriller. My hope is that residents will come out and support the event,” Vashil said.

His fellow student, Stefan, was inspired to study film after beating two types of cancer.

“I had lung and bone cancer and while I was undergoing chemotheraphy I began making short films. It was sort of an escape for me and allowed me to forget about what I was going through. The experimental film festival for me has a very cool concept, there are no rules to follow and I’ve called my film Portrait Of A Lifehouse which in a way mirrors my journey. It’s all very metaphorical,” he explained.

Fellow third year student, Tayla-Rae said she was excited about Durban hosting its first experimental festival.

“When we were each given our projects, we were told to challenge the norms and I think that’s what I did with my film, Luna, which is a fantasy film. I think people will enjoy it but you have to watch it to find out more,” she said.
